Why is a 48-inch frost line depth critical for fence posts in Queensbury Central?

The 48-inch frost depth protects against frost heave. When footings are set above this line, freeze-thaw cycles lift posts out of the ground, creating a hazardous and unstable fence. For a durable perimeter in Queensbury Central, the IRC requires post footings to extend below the 48-inch frost line. This prevents structural failure and costly repairs.

What is the utility locate process, and why is it mandatory before digging?

You must call 811 Dig Safely New York at least two business days before excavation. They mark public utility lines for free. Hitting an unmarked gas, electric, or fiber line in Queensbury Central is a major liability that can result in service outages, fines, and repair costs. How do moderate termite risk and soil corrosivity affect my fence material choice in Queensbury?

Moderate soil corrosivity accelerates rust on standard steel fasteners, causing unsightly streaks. Use hot-dip galvanized or stainless steel brackets and screws. While termite risk is moderate, pressure-treated wood or composite materials provide superior resistance. Material compatibility with local soil conditions prevents premature deterioration.

How does a 115 MPH V-ult wind load rating change my fence design?

A 115 MPH V-ult wind speed, per ASCE 7-22 standards, dictates structural design. This rating requires closer post spacing, deeper concrete footings, and wind-rated brackets to resist uplift. Standard spacing often fails during peak storm season gusts off I-87. Engineering for the V-ult load is non-negotiable for long-term stability.

Am I legally required to notify my neighbor before replacing a shared boundary fence in Queensbury?

Yes. New York Real Property Actions and Proceedings Law 843, the 'Good Neighbor Fence Act,' requires written notice to adjoining owners before replacing a shared partition fence. Failure to provide this notice in Queensbury can result in legal disputes and liability for the full cost. Proactive communication is a standard requirement for 2026 projects.
